Как вы определяете CFBundleIcons, CFBundleIconFiles, CFBundleIconFile?
Это мой первый раз, отправляя приложение в App store, так что, пожалуйста, нести со мной. Я использую iOS 6.0.
мне удалось добраться до последнего шага, где мне нужно было проверить и отправить мое приложение в Apple для оценки, чтобы поместить его в AppStore. Однако, в самом конце, он дал мне это сообщение об ошибке во время проверки:
Итак, я проверил информацию.plist файл, чтобы убедиться, что я включил все необходимые значки для приложения. Они у меня были. все.
Это моя информация.файл plist:
В разделе "файл значков", "файлы значков" и "файлы значков (iOS 5)" я предоставил значок по умолчанию 57x57, значок для iPad и значок для iPhone. Они присутствуют в одном каталоге файла проекта.
Что я пропустила? (Я попытался добавить записи под названием "CFBundleIcons / File / Files", но таких записей не было добавлено).
Ниже приведена моя обновленная информация.plist после I последовал совету rmaddy:
теперь, когда все файлы значков были обновлены правильно с правильными размерами (без предупреждения желтый треугольник над изображениями на вкладке сводка). Почему я все еще получаю это же сообщение об ошибке? Что еще я упускаю?
2 ответов
самый простой способ обеспечить правильную настройку всех ваших значков и изображений запуска-перейти на вкладку сводка для цели вашего проекта (или целей, если их больше одного) в Xcode. На вкладке сводка находится раздел для iPhone / iPod touch Deployment Info и другой для iPad Deployment Info. В каждом из этих двух разделов есть место для значков приложений и изображений запуска. Нажмите на каждый и загрузите правильное изображение. Если появляется желтый предупреждающий треугольник, то изображение имеет неправильный размер или возможно некоторые другой вопрос. Заполнение всех изображений таким образом будет правильно обновлять вашу информацию.plist с правильными записями.
экрана вы выложили ясно, вы пытаетесь поставить запуск изображения (по умолчанию.png) и некоторые снимки экрана, где ваши значки принадлежат. По умолчанию.png-это изображение запуска. Снимки экрана не идут никуда в вашем проекте. Они загружаются в iTunes Connect.
в моем случае я решил проблему, убедившись, что имена в файле plist соответствуют именам файлов в разделе Общие - >значки приложений. Он должен иметь точно такой же случай